%I A095677 #7 Feb 22 2013 14:39:04 %S A095677 1,1,2,6,8,4,54,72,36,8,680,896,480,128,16,11000,14400,8000,2400,400, %T A095677 32,217392,283392,161280,51840,10080,1152,64,5076400,6598144,3819648, %U A095677 1285760,274400,37632,3136,128,136761984,177373184,103993344 %N A095677 Triangle T(n,k), 0<=k<=n, read by rows, defined by Sum_{k = 0..n} T(n,k)*x^k = Sum_{k = 0..n} binomial(n,k)*(x+k)^n. %F A095677 T(n, k) = binomial(n, k)*Sum_{j = 0..n} = binomial(n, j)*j^(n-k). %F A095677 T(n, n) = 2^n, see A000079. %F A095677 T(n+1, n) = (n+1)^2*2^n, see A014477. %F A095677 T(n, 0) = n*Sum_{k = 0..n-1} T(n-1, k). %e A095677 1; 1, 2; 6, 8, 4; 54, 72, 36, 8; 680, 896, 480, 128, 16; ... %K A095677 nonn,tabl %O A095677 0,3 %A A095677 _Philippe Deléham_ Jul 04 2004
